There’s a new gaming headset in town and its got all the bells and whistles in a closed-back design. Meet Sennheiser GSP 300 gaming headset.

Designed to provide exceptional sound and depth of field, the GSP 300 iterates the sound quality found in other Sennheiser products with a little extra oomph. Sennheiser advises, this headphone has been designed specifically to deliver on bass resonance – allowing for a more immersive and realistic gaming experience. The ear cups and extenders are held together with a clever-ball joint hinge so the user can adjust the headset at an angle best suited for their face. Plus, the ear cushions are comprised of memory foam to further maximize comfort and ensure supreme sound isolation.

The attached boom mic is equipped with broadcast quality noise-cancelling technology to minimize background noise. It’s short length is designed to cut out any breathing noises that can be picked up by the mic. Simply raising the arm of the boom stick will mute the audio signal.

The headband showcases a split aviation cut. This design alleviates pressure from the top of the head allowing for a more comfortable fit, especially during long gaming sessions.

“This headset represents a new design era and an increased commitment to our gaming range,” explains Andreas Jessen, Product Manager Gaming, Sennheiser Communications A/S. “Our product philosophy starts with a single-minded focus on supporting the gamer, blending rugged durable styling with the with the features and performance that gamers have come to expect from Sennheiser. The GSP 300 delivers a significant upgrade to your audio and lets you hear the game as it was intended.”

Thanks to Sennheiser’s PCV 05 combo audio adapter gamers can use the GSP 300 on multiple platforms such as PCs, Macbooks, consoles, and tablets.

The Sennheiser GSP 300 was presented to the public for the first time at Gamescom 2016 in Cologne on August 17th. It will be available for purchase at the end of September 2016.
